Code No. P0112: Intake Air Temperature Sensor Circuit Low Input




OPERATION



  • A power voltage of 5 V is applied to the intake air temperature sensor output terminal (terminal No. 3) of manifold absolute pressure sensor from the engine-ECU (terminal No. 89).
  • The power voltage is earthed to the engine-ECU (terminal No. 46) from the intake air temperature sensor (terminal No. 4).

FUNCTION



  • The intake air temperature sensor converts the intake air temperature into a voltage and inputs the voltage signal to the engine-ECU.
  • In response to the signal, the engine-ECU corrects the fuel injection amount, etc.
  • The intake air temperature sensor is a kind of resistor, which has characteristics to reduce its resistance as the intake air temperature rises. Therefore, the sensor output voltage varies with the intake air temperature, and becomes lower as the intake air temperature rises.

TROUBLE JUDGMENT


Check Condition
  • More than 2 seconds have passed since the engine starting sequence was completed.
Judgement Criterion
  • Intake air temperature sensor output voltage is less than 0.2 V (corresponding to an intake air temperature of 115°C or more) for 2 seconds.

FAIL-SAFE AND BACKUP FUNCTION



  • Control as if the intake air temperature is 25°C.

PROBABLE CAUSES



  • Failed intake air temperature sensor
  • Short circuit in intake air temperature sensor circuit or loose connector contact
  • Failed engine-ECU
